LAS VEGAS--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Nov. 20, 2002

AirZip, Inc., the leader in security and speed software for networked information, today announced its AirZip Document Secure software product for persistent security was selected from hundreds of entries as one of three finalists in the information security category for the Best of Show Awards at Fall Comdex.

AirZip Document Secure, officially launched at Comdex yesterday, enables companies to have persistent control over whether or not documents can be viewed, printed, saved, copied, forwarded or changed in any way, with access rules that live with the document at all times. The product is the only one of its kind which can be integrated into and has built-in compatibility with existing infrastructure, and which uses 256-bit AES encryption. The software also provides an audit trail for activity tracking, real-time revoking of access permissions and the ability to control versions of documents.
